State lawmakers are considering a measure aimed at increasing the safety of parking garages across Wisconsin.
A bipartisan bill that has been introduced in Madison would require the structures to undergo inspections every five years. The push comes after a garage at the Bayshore Mall in Glendale partially collapsed in 2023, stranding several cars. Back in 2010, a section of concrete fell from a parking structure in Milwaukee County, killing a teenager and leaving two other people hurt.
